A plan of dissolution is a written description of how an entity intends to dissolve, or officially and formally close the business. A plan of dissolution will include a description of how any remaining assets and liabilities will be distributed.

New Mexico Dissolution FAQs LLCs that want to dissolve have to pay $25 for the filing fee. For same-day processing, you can pay an additional $300. Two-day processing requires an additional $200.

To dissolve your New Mexico corporation you must file both the Statement of Intent to Dissolve and the Articles of Dissolution. Each one requires a $50 filing fee. Payment must be made by check or money order. You may expedite processing of your dissolution by the PRC.
